A can contains a gas with a volume of 86 mL at 30oC. What is the volume in the can if it is heated to 65oC?

Respuesta :

PiaDeveau PiaDeveau
  • 16-03-2021

Answer:

New volume of gas = 95.93 ml (Approx)

Explanation:

Given:

Old volume of gas = 86 ml

Old temperature = 30°C = 30 + 273 = 303 K

New temperature = 65°C = 65 + 273 = 338 K

Find:

New volume of gas

Computation:

V1T2 = V2T1

(86)(338) = (V2)(303)

New volume of gas = 95.93 ml (Approx)
